For instance, take the court case of one teen who has decided to sue her parents for college tuition. True story. But there's more to the story than you can imagine.

Rachel Canning is bright. She's an honor student and plays sports in school, and she's 18 years old. However, because she's not willing to abide by her parents house rules, she decided to move out and live with a friend. Now, she's seeking money from her parents to pay for her college.
